Default Pictures/info. on my new fox sleeper

I bought a 1980 ford thunderbird on sunday, which i'm going to be putting either the 400 (351M originally) into, or the GT40p headed long block from my grey mustang (GT). More likely the 302, but i figure it's the perfect sleeper.
i bought it for $475 and the body is completely straight (needs some trim....that'll be hard to find) and the interior is about 99% perfect save for a little bit of fading on some panels and a couple of scratches. I'm seriously debating on if i'm going to keep it looking so stock that i use ported exhaust manifolds or if i'll use stuff like my MSD distributor/ignition and headers.....hmmm.....so my ideas that i like.
It has the 120 horsepower computer carbureted 255 windsor right now which is hilarious because i've never had a windsor that is so underpowered.....it actually has decent torque, but man does it die after about 2500 rpm.
what do you guys think i should do? I want to be able to open the hood and have anyone who looks at it think it's stock. How loud should the exhaust be? I could make it sound wicked or keep it subdued and stealthy....
